Description

### Integration Name

Linux Metrics [packages/linux]

### Dataset Name

linux.service

### Integration Version

1.1.0

### Agent Version

8.19.14

### Agent Output Type

elasticsearch

### Elasticsearch Version

8.19.14

### OS Version and Architecture

RHEL 8.8 and 9.6

### Software/API Version

_No response_

### Error Message

Error fetching data for metricset system.service: error getting list of running units: dbus: connection closed by user.

### Event Original

_No response_

### What did you do?

The issue can be resolved by restarting the Elastic Agent service.

### What did you see?

The agent switches to an "Unhealthy" state, stops sending data, and instead creates documents containing the attached error.

### What did you expect to see?

Automatic recovery of the agent if the connection to D-Bus is closed for any reason.
